AI Overviews are Google’s AI-generated answer boxes that sit above traditional search results. When triggered, they synthesize information from multiple web sources into a single, conversational summary. The searcher often gets what they need without clicking any link.
For local businesses, this creates a two-tier system. Tier one: businesses that AI trusts enough to cite and recommend. Tier two: everyone else, buried below a wall of AI-generated content that most users never scroll past.
The data backs this up. Recent studies show AI Overviews reduce organic click-through rates by roughly 58%. That doesn’t mean search traffic is dying. It means the traffic is concentrating on fewer, more trusted sources. If you’re one of those sources, your lead quality actually improves. If you’re not, your traffic falls off a cliff.
AI search systems don’t guess. They validate. Here’s what Google’s AI evaluates when deciding which local businesses to include in an Overview:
Google Business Profile completeness and activity. Your GBP is now your most important digital asset. AI systems pull directly from your profile categories, services, photos, posts, and Q&A responses. Businesses with complete, active profiles get recommended. Those with stale profiles from 2022 don’t.
Structured data clarity. Schema markup tells AI exactly what you do, where you’re located, what you charge, and what your customers say about you. Without it, AI has to guess from your page content, and it often guesses wrong or skips you entirely.
Content that answers questions directly. AI Overviews extract information from pages structured with clear question-and-answer formatting. If your service pages read like brochures instead of answering specific customer questions, you’re not extractable.
Review volume and recency. Businesses with consistent, recent reviews carry more trust signal. A business with 150 reviews and active owner responses outweighs one with 30 reviews from three years ago, regardless of star rating.
Entity consistency across the web. If your business name, address, phone number, and service descriptions differ between your website, GBP, directories, and social profiles, AI can’t confidently verify your identity. Consistency equals trust.
Post weekly updates with photos. Answer every Q&A. Respond to every review within 48 hours using service and location terminology naturally. Ensure your categories are specific, not generic. If you’re a marriage counsellor, your primary category should be “Marriage Counselor” not just “Counselor.”
At minimum, your website needs LocalBusiness schema on your homepage, Service schema on each service page, FAQPage schema wherever you answer customer questions, and BreadcrumbList schema for site navigation clarity. This is not optional anymore. Schema is the language AI speaks. Without it, you’re mute in the conversations that matter most.
Every service page should anticipate and directly answer the questions your customers ask. Not in a buried FAQ section at the bottom, but throughout the page content. Structure your H2s as questions. Provide clear, concise answers in the first 100 words after each heading. This is exactly the format AI systems extract from.
Publishing 50 thin blog posts does nothing for AI visibility. One comprehensive, experience-driven guide that demonstrates genuine expertise on a topic will outperform a hundred generic articles. AI systems evaluate content depth, originality, and whether the author has demonstrable experience in the subject.
AEO (Answer Engine Optimization) is the practice of optimizing specifically for AI-generated answers. This means structuring your content so AI can extract clean, quotable snippets. Use clear definitions. Provide specific numbers and data points. Write in a factual, authoritative tone rather than marketing speak.
Professional services like law firms, accounting practices, and consulting firms benefit most from FAQ schema and detailed service descriptions. Trades and construction companies need strong GBP signals, geo-tagged photos, and service-area clarity. Healthcare providers, including therapists and counsellors, need YMYL-compliant content with clear credential signals. Retail and hospitality businesses should focus on review velocity and Google Posts activity.
